HF04 HGU is a 2004 Aprilia Sonic in Black with a 49c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 2004 Aprilia Sonic models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.6% with a typical mileage of 8,261 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Aprilia Sonic fails its MOT is steering headbearing has excessive free play, accounting for 213 recorded failures. If you're considering buying HF04 HGU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Aprilia Sonic typ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 22 years old, this Aprilia Sonic is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
